  • Patent number: 7675446
    Abstract: A filter applied in a sigma-delta modulator includes an integrator, a signal attenuator and a feedback circuit, in which these components are connected in series sequentially to form a local feedback circuit. The integrator integrates an input signal to output an integral signal. Accordingly, the signal attenuator attenuates the integral signal to output an attenuation signal to the local feedback circuit so as to share a part of attenuation amount to reduce the chip area of the sigma-delta modulator.

  • Patent number: 7619753
    Abstract: A method of measuring dimensions for an optical system to measure the critical dimension of a sample object according to this aspect of the present invention includes the steps of preparing a plurality of standard objects, selecting a predetermined focus metric algorithm, performing an analyzing process on each standard object to generate a plurality of focus metric distributions using the predetermined focus metric algorithm, analyzing the focus metric distributions to determine a target order, generating a reference relation, acquiring a measured characteristic value from the sample object, and determining the critical dimension of the sample object based on the measured characteristic value and the reference relation. Each standard object has a grating-shaped standard pattern with a predetermined pitch and line width. The focus metric algorithm is a gradient energy method, a Laplacian method, a standard deviation method, or a contrast method.
